Summary

  • Dr. Lawrence Greenfield, based in San Mateo, CA, specializes in research with a robust background in molecular biology, genetics, pharmacology, drug development, and next-generation sequencing. He completed his medical education and fellowship at UCLA, supplemented by a Ph.D. in Molecular Biology from the University of California. Dr. Greenfield has held prominent positions in several biotechnological companies, currently serving as the owner of Larry Greenfield Consulting, LLC. His work includes multiple highly-cited publications. Throughout his career, he has been recognized with honors like a fellowship from the National Academy of Clinical Biochemistry and a National Research Service Award from the National Institute of Allergy and Infectious Diseases.
